"There's something to be said for being an orphan." Beryl stared into her cocoa mug; cocoa, by all that's sacred, please, not tea. "Or being raised by wolves."
"I hear you." Evangaline stared at her own mug - coffee, for much the same reason the Beryl was drinking cocoa. The whole family to come to to complain, and her niece had come to the Aunt. "They can be a bit of a double-edged sword."
"They have another edge?" She rubbed her knuckles with her thumbs; Eva found herself wincing in empathy.
